Understanding the Importance of an EIN
If you’re operating a business in Marbury, Alabama, you might need to obtain an Employer Identification Number (EIN). This unique nine-digit number, issued by the IRS, is essential for various business activities, such as filing taxes, hiring employees, and opening a business bank account. Understanding how to get an EIN number is crucial for compliance and operational efficiency.

Eligibility Criteria for an EIN
Before you dive into the application process, it’s important to know if you’re eligible to apply for an EIN. Generally, any business entity, such as sole proprietorships, partnerships, corporations, or nonprofits, can apply for an EIN. Additionally, if you plan to hire employees or operate as a corporation or partnership, obtaining an EIN is mandatory.
Who Needs an EIN?
- Businesses with employees
- Corporations and partnerships
- Nonprofit organizations
- Estates and trusts
- Businesses involved in specific industries (like banking and insurance)
Step-by-Step Guide to Applying for an EIN
Ready to get an EIN number? Here’s a straightforward process to help you navigate the application:
- Determine Your Eligibility: Ensure your business type qualifies for an EIN.
- Gather Necessary Information: Collect information like your business structure, legal name, and address.
- Complete the Application: You can apply online, by mail, or by fax. The online application is the fastest way.
- Submit Your Application: For online applications, you’ll receive your EIN immediately upon completion. For mail or fax applications, it may take several weeks.
Avoiding Common Pitfalls
While applying for an EIN is relatively straightforward, some common mistakes can delay your application:
- Providing incorrect information, such as misspellings in your business name or address.
- Not understanding your business structure can lead to the wrong application being submitted.
- Failing to apply for an EIN before hiring employees or opening a business bank account.
To ensure a smooth process, double-check your application details and consider seeking assistance if needed.
